Output baccbc8e20aafd75cbd6118b65b5bba1f91d4e7a40a75e6064cecc3baeb2e58f:15

value
19795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6982ff1b6e4aecaa23460b8aee2ac8ae1d57a1d OP_EQUAL
address
3MFgqke1BuXQoVrLspHDcorp9XQTha77oX
transaction
baccbc8e20aafd75cbd6118b65b5bba1f91d4e7a40a75e6064cecc3baeb2e58f
confirmations
881
spent
true